
使用lumberjack库可实现Go日志自动轮转与归档,支持按大小或时间切割、压缩旧文件,并兼容标准log和zap日志库;结合zap可输出结构化JSON日志;也可自定义按天归档逻辑,通过文件重命名和信号触发实现,确保系统稳定高效运行。 本文深入探讨了在Laravel数据库事务重试过程中,如何有效获取...

</li> <li> <strong>失败登录尝试的限制</strong>:防止暴力破解密码,对失败的登录尝试进行计数,达到一定次数后暂时锁定账户或IP。 另外,DOM会将空白和换行视为文本节点,遍历时可能需要过滤。 错误处理: 如果遇到无法解码的字节...

现在,其他人就可以使用以下命令获取你的 newmath 包:go get github.com/username/newmath并在他们的代码中导入: GitHub Copilot GitHub AI编程工具,实时编程建议 48 查看详情 import "github.com/username/ne...

这意味着您的自定义字段将显示在该区域的底部。 双引号 (" "):允许 Shell 进行变量扩展和命令替换。 XML Vocabulary 定义了 XML 文档的“说什么”,而 XML Schema 定义了“怎么说”。 在这种情况下,您需要调整操作系统的文件句柄限制。 df_struct = df_...

通过本文介绍的两种方法,你可以根据实际需求选择合适的方法来动态替换字符串中的字符或单词,从而更有效地处理文本数据。 错误处理:Go应用程序和Apps Script脚本都应包含健壮的错误处理机制。 该通道每隔100毫秒就会发送一个当前时间值。 正确的做法是使用布尔表达式进行比较,例如data['tod...

... 2 查看详情 <?php $options = getopt("f:v:", ["file:", "verbose::"]); if (isset($options['f']) || isset($options['file'])) { $file = $options['f'] ??...

您可以通过 Go Modules 引入:go get golang.org/x/oauth2 go get golang.org/x/oauth2/google # 用于 Google 特定的 OAuth2 端点2.2 Google Cloud Console 配置 创建或选择项目:登录 Googl...

implode() 函数的语法是 implode(separator, array): AiPPT模板广场 AiPPT模板广场-PPT模板-word文档模板-excel表格模板 50 查看详情 separator:可选。 预处理语句的优势: 参数化查询: 将SQL语句和数据分开处理,数据库会先编译S...

本文旨在帮助初学者理解 Go 语言中结构体的使用,重点讲解方法中指针接收者与值接收者的区别,以及如何正确地修改结构体内部状态。 监控资源使用情况,并考虑优化SVG内容或分块处理(如果可能)。 原理与优势 此方法的关键在于利用了Conan configure()方法的灵活性和export-pkg命令的...

这样,内部的双引号就不需要转义。 通过实际代码示例,展示了如何高效地组织数据,确保分组准确性及子元素计数的灵活性,尤其适用于需要动态布局的场景。 1. 获取百度AI平台权限 在调用百度语音识别API前,必须先注册百度AI开放平台账号,并创建应用以获取凭证信息。 Batch Normalization...